The Israeli Ministry of Defense and the Dutch Ministry of Defense signed yesterday (Wednesday) the first defense export agreement between the countries, for the supply of artillery rocket launcher systems manufactured by Elbit Systems. The scope of the transaction – more than 1.1 billion shekels (305 million dollars). Defense Minister Yoav Galant: “Thanks to the security solutions that are developed and produced in the defense industries, we are strengthening ties with the countries of the world, fortifying our security and strengthening Israel’s position.”
According to the signed agreement, Elbit Systems will supply 20 PULS type artillery rocket launcher systems, a package of rockets and missiles with different ranges and training and support services to the Dutch army. The Israeli company’s PULS system provides a comprehensive and cost-effective solution that supports the firing of both “free” rockets and precision guided rockets and missiles, at ranges of 12 km to 300 km. The $305 million contract will be implemented over a period of five years.

The giant deal comes against the background of the war in Ukraine and the fear of the European countries from Putin. Many armies on the continent have accelerated their preparations for military conflicts – and are going on a “shopping spree” in the Israeli arms industry. The war gave birth to new insights in the security field, including the emphasis on the importance of artillery and rocket launch systems, attacking drones, precision missiles and rockets, and anti-tank and anti-aircraft defense systems and air defense. European countries are purchasing and accelerating the purchase of weapon systems, including NATO – and the Israeli industry is very successful.
